No 26. Denis Morris Reds (2-0) v.s No. 27 Saint Paul Patriots (2-0)

Everybody involved knew it was coming, and finally the day is here as the #CFC50Ā No.26 Denis Morris Reds prepare to cross paths with the #CFC50 No.27 Saint Paul Patriots in a highly anticipated NCAA matchup.

After two weeks of regular season play, the Reds are staring eye to eye in the standings with a Patriots team who have looked dominant defeating Notre Dame 42-17, followed up with a 28-7 victory over Lakeshore. There are not many secrets between these two undefeated squads having battled each other in the past, but Denis Morris is aware that Saint Paul always have a trick or two up their sleeves when the pair collide. Redsā€™ Head Coach Rob Battista knows that his team will be in for a long afternoon of football, but hopes that his boys will be prepared to handle the unexpected when their opponents inevitably try to shake things up,

ā€œSt Paul is a well coached team and they are always prepared. We need to concentrate on our timing and execute well.ā€ Battista explains. ā€œSt Paul always brings a new wrinkle on both sides of the ball. We need to prepare our guys so that they are not caught off guard.ā€

On the flip side, a Redsā€™ aerial attack led by quarterback Travis Arp and his band of talented wideouts will be looking for a way to throw the Patriots off of their game. Feeding off of Arpā€™s experience, wide receivers Cam Calder, Hayden Riley and Dylan Warnock have all excelled making big plays for their quarterback when needed. Although Denis Morris may be a bit green along the trenches with a lot of newcomers playing bigger roles, Battista has a ton confident in his playmakers to carry the load and ease the transition for their younger players,

ā€œOur strengths on both side of the ball are our skill positions. Newcomer Owen Wallace has been stellar on punt returns and has also made an impact at receiver, while Austin Pilato has been running the ball well. We have inexperience on both the offensive and defensive line, but our quarterback is in his second year of the program and has a strong grasp of the offence.ā€

On defence, the Reds main goal will be to corral a nasty Patriotsā€™ running attack led by standout Cam Lang. In order to do so, they will be relying heavily on halfback Mike Domanico and linebacker Jack Andrews – who Battista says have been all over the field making tackles in their first two games. Denis Morris will also be looking towards their defensive line to step up and plug some holes in both the run and pass game,

ā€œRob Hough has been disruptive coming off the edge, and newcomer at defensive end Latrell Harris is starting to come into his own after two years away from the game.ā€

ThisĀ #CFC50Ā  showdown will not be for the faint of heart with each program prepared to stake their claim as the team to beat in the NCAA. With Denis Morris taking control in each game theyā€™ve played this season – including a 36-7 win versus Saint Michael last week – Battista has a very simple message that he hopes will lead his team to victory once again,

ā€œKeep focused and do your job first. Be where you are supposed to be.ā€

The action is set to kick off on October 5th at 7:00pm.
